Cryptocurrency arbitrage is a strategy used by traders to profit from the price discrepancies of a particular digital currency across different exchanges. This technique involves buying a cryptocurrency from one exchange where the price is lower and selling it on another exchange where the price is higher, thereby making a profit from the price difference.
In this article, we’ll go deeper into the mechanics and opportunities of cryptocurrency arbitrage. We’ll cover in detail the various types of arbitrage techniques, the benefits they present, and the risks involved. Also, we’ll explore some of the specialized tools and techniques arbitrageurs use to efficiently capture these fleeting anomalies at maximum speed.
Key Takeaways
- Cryptocurrency arbitrage involves taking advantage of price disparities between different exchanges to make a profit.
- Best practices for cryptocurrency arbitrage include thorough research and analysis, starting with reputable exchanges, implementing risk management strategies, real-time monitoring, and efficient execution.
- Traders should consider factors such as trading volumes, liquidity, deposit and withdrawal times and fees, and currency conversion risks when evaluating arbitrage opportunities.
- Utilizing arbitrage bots and software can enhance the speed and accuracy of executing trades.
- Continuous learning, compliance with regulations, and keeping records of trades and performance are important for long-term success in cryptocurrency arbitrage.
What is Cryptocurrency Arbitrage?
Arbitrage involves using the same capital to generate risk-free profits from temporary price inefficiencies in related markets or instruments. In simpler terms, it’s about simultaneously buying an asset for a low price in one location and selling it for a higher price elsewhere.
For example, if the price of Bitcoin was $10,000 on Exchange A but $9,900 on Exchange B, an arbitrageur could buy 1 BTC on Exchange B for $9,900 and immediately sell it on Exchange A for $10,000. This $100 difference represents the risk-free profit potential from that particular arbitrage opportunity.
Of course, the price discrepancies tend to be much smaller in reality, often just fractions of a percent. But with enough capital deployed across multiple trades, these small margins can add up to significant returns.
Importantly, arbitrage opportunities in crypto exist due to slight inefficiencies as liquidity, order books, and markets constantly evolve on various platforms across the globe. Minor hiccups or delays provide momentary windows for arbitrageurs to capitalize.
The key is identifying and capturing these anomalies before prices reconcile, which requires fast execution speeds that far exceed human abilities.
Benefits of Cryptocurrency Arbitrage
While crypto markets experience bouts of extreme volatility, arbitrage strategies are designed to generate reliable income regardless of overall price movements or sentiment. The arbitrage “edge” exists solely due to transient pricing anomalies rather than market directionality.
For many traders, this aspects offers two primary benefits:
Consistent Returns
Due to its risk-free nature when executed properly, arbitrage provides a steady, relatively low-risk way to profit from cryptocurrency trading. Study after study shows arbitrage strategies producing positive returns in all conditions. Of course, the degree of consistency depends on one’s ability to consistently find and capture those fleeting arbitrage opportunities amid intense competition.
Portfolio Diversification
By serving as a non-correlated alpha strategy, arbitrage acts as an effective diversifier within a mixed portfolio. It helps mitigate overall risk exposure compared to solely holding or trading based on market speculation.
Types of Cryptocurrency Arbitrage
There are several major types of cryptocurrency arbitrage techniques that traders employ to capitalize on these opportunities. Let’s explore four of the most common types:
1. Spatial Cryptocurrency Arbitrage Techniques
Spatial arbitrage is a popular type of cryptocurrency arbitrage that involves exploiting price disparities between different exchanges at the same time. Traders aim to identify instances where a particular cryptocurrency is priced higher on one exchange compared to another, enabling them to buy at a lower price and sell at a higher price, thereby making a profit. Let’s discuss the various techniques and considerations for successful spatial cryptocurrency arbitrage.
Identifying Price Disparities Across Exchanges
To engage in spatial arbitrage effectively, traders need to identify price disparities across different cryptocurrency exchanges. Several tools and methods can assist in this process:
Price Aggregators and Comparison Tools: Price aggregators gather data from multiple exchanges and display the prices of various cryptocurrencies in real-time, allowing traders to compare prices across platforms. These tools provide a comprehensive overview of the market and help identify exchanges with price discrepancies.
Monitoring Order Books and Depth Charts: Traders can analyze order books and depth charts on different exchanges to identify potential opportunities. Order books display the current buy and sell orders for a particular cryptocurrency, while depth charts provide a visual representation of the supply and demand levels at different price points. By monitoring these data, traders can identify exchanges where the buy or sell orders are imbalanced, leading to price disparities.
Evaluating Exchange Fees and Transaction Costs
When engaging in spatial arbitrage, traders must consider exchange fees and transaction costs. These additional expenses can impact the profitability of the arbitrage strategy. Traders should compare the fees charged by different exchanges and calculate the overall transaction costs involved, including deposit and withdrawal fees..
Executing Trades Efficiently and Minimizing Risks
Efficient execution and risk management are crucial in spatial arbitrage. Traders should consider the following factors:
Deposit and Withdrawal Times: Each exchange has its own processing times for deposits and withdrawals. Traders need to factor in these times when executing spatial arbitrage trades. Delays in deposit or withdrawal processes can impact the speed and profitability of the arbitrage strategy.
Managing Counterparty Risk: Spatial arbitrage involves engaging with different exchanges and counterparties. Traders should assess the reputation, security measures, and reliability of the exchanges they plan to trade on. Choosing reputable and trustworthy exchanges helps mitigate counterparty risks and enhances the overall security of the arbitrage process.
2. Cross-Exchange Cryptocurrency Arbitrage Techniques
Cross-exchange cryptocurrency arbitrage involves taking advantage of price disparities between different cryptocurrency exchanges. Traders identify instances where a particular cryptocurrency is priced higher on one exchange compared to another, allowing them to buy at a lower price and sell at a higher price, thereby making a profit. This section will discuss various techniques and considerations for successful cross-exchange cryptocurrency arbitrage.
Identifying Arbitrage Opportunities between Exchanges
To engage in cross-exchange arbitrage effectively, traders need to identify potential arbitrage opportunities. They can do so by comparing cryptocurrency prices across multiple exchanges in real-time. Various tools and platforms provide price aggregators and comparison features, enabling traders to monitor price disparities and identify potential profitable trades.
Evaluating Trading Volumes and Liquidity
Trading volumes and liquidity play a crucial role in cross-exchange arbitrage. Higher trading volumes and sufficient liquidity facilitate faster execution of trades and reduce the risk of slippage. Traders should prioritize exchanges with higher trading volumes and liquidity to ensure smooth and efficient arbitrage transactions.
Assessing Deposit and Withdrawal Times and Fees
The speed and cost of deposits and withdrawals are important considerations in cross-exchange arbitrage. Traders should evaluate the processing times and fees associated with depositing and withdrawing funds from different exchanges. Delays in deposit or withdrawal processes can impact the speed and profitability of the arbitrage strategy. Additionally, traders should factor in any deposit or withdrawal fees charged by exchanges to accurately assess the overall transaction costs.
Managing Currency Conversion Risks
Cross-exchange arbitrage often involves converting cryptocurrencies between different exchanges. Traders must be mindful of currency conversion risks, including exchange rate fluctuations and transaction fees associated with converting one cryptocurrency to another. It is important to carefully evaluate the rates and fees offered by exchanges for currency conversions to optimize the profitability of arbitrage trades
3. Temporal Cryptocurrency Arbitrage Techniques
Temporal arbitrage, also known as time arbitrage, is a type of cryptocurrency arbitrage that focuses on exploiting price discrepancies over time. Traders analyze historical price data, patterns, and trends to identify opportunities where prices have deviated significantly from their expected values. This section will delve into various techniques and considerations for successful temporal cryptocurrency arbitrage.
Analyzing Historical Price Data
To engage in temporal arbitrage, traders rely on analyzing historical price data of cryptocurrencies. They examine charts and graphs to identify patterns, trends, and anomalies that can indicate potential price discrepancies. Technical analysis tools and indicators are commonly used to identify entry and exit points for trades. These tools may include moving averages, trend lines, oscillators, and other indicators that help traders assess market conditions and predict future price movements.
Identifying Price Deviations from Expected Values
Temporal arbitrage involves identifying instances where cryptocurrency prices have deviated significantly from their expected values. Traders may employ various strategies to identify such deviations, including:
Mean Reversion: Mean reversion is a common strategy in temporal arbitrage. It assumes that prices will eventually revert to their mean or average values after deviating. Traders identify instances where prices have deviated significantly from historical averages and take positions with the expectation of prices returning to their mean.
Statistical Analysis: Traders may utilize statistical modeling and analysis techniques to identify price deviations. These techniques involve assessing factors such as standard deviations, volatility, and correlation coefficients to identify outliers and potential arbitrage opportunities.
Timing Trades for Optimal Profitability
Timing is crucial in temporal arbitrage. Traders aim to enter trades at the most opportune moments to maximize profitability. They consider factors such as market liquidity, trading volumes, and market sentiment to determine the optimal timing for executing trades. Additionally, traders may leverage automation tools and trading bots to execute trades swiftly and accurately based on predetermined criteria.
Risk Management Strategies
As with any arbitrage strategy, risk management is essential in temporal arbitrage. Traders should consider implementing the following risk management techniques:
Stop Loss Orders: Traders can set stop loss orders to automatically exit a trade if prices move against their expectations. This helps limit potential losses in case the expected price reversal does not materialize.
Position Sizing: Traders should carefully determine the size of their positions relative to their overall portfolio. By allocating appropriate capital to each trade, traders can manage risk and mitigate potential losses.
Diversification: Diversifying trades across different cryptocurrencies and exchanges can help reduce the risk associated with temporal arbitrage. By spreading investments, traders can minimize the impact of adverse price movements in any single asset or exchange.
Adapting to Changing Market Conditions
Cryptocurrency markets are highly dynamic and subject to rapid changes. Traders engaging in temporal arbitrage must remain adaptable and adjust their strategies as market conditions evolve. They should stay updated with market news, regulatory developments, and technological advancements that may impact price movements and arbitrage opportunities.
4. Statistical Cryptocurrency Arbitrage Technique
Statistical arbitrage is a popular trading strategy that aims to capitalize on statistical patterns and relationships between securities or assets. It is based on the principle that certain securities or assets may exhibit predictable relationships or patterns in their prices or performance over time. These patterns can be identified through statistical analysis and historical data. Traders using this technique seek to exploit these patterns by simultaneously buying and selling correlated securities to capture profit from temporary price discrepancies.
Key Principles of Statistical Arbitrage
Correlation: Statistical arbitrage relies on identifying securities or assets that have a high degree of correlation. This means that their prices tend to move in a similar manner or direction.
Mean Reversion: The strategy also leverages the concept of mean reversion, which suggests that prices that have deviated from their historical average tend to revert back to that average over time. Traders look for instances where the prices of correlated securities have diverged and anticipate their eventual convergence.\
Steps in Implementing Statistical Arbitrage
Data Collection and Analysis: Traders gather historical price data for the securities they wish to analyze. They use statistical tools and models to identify correlations and patterns.
Strategy Development: Based on the analysis, traders develop a statistical arbitrage strategy. This may involve selecting appropriate securities, determining entry and exit points, and setting risk management parameters.
Backtesting: Traders backtest their strategy using historical data to assess its performance and validate its effectiveness. This step helps refine the strategy and optimize its parameters.
Execution: Once the strategy has been tested and refined, traders implement it in real-time trading. They monitor the selected securities and execute trades when the identified price discrepancies meet the predetermined criteria.
Risk Management in Statistical Arbitrage
Effective risk management is essential in statistical arbitrage. Traders should set risk limits, such as stop-loss orders, to control potential losses. They also need to monitor the performance of the strategy and make adjustments if market conditions or correlations change.
Technology and Automation
Statistical arbitrage often involves complex calculations and analysis, making technology and automation crucial. Traders use advanced software, algorithmic trading platforms, and statistical models to efficiently identify and execute trades in real-time.
Continuous Monitoring and Adaptation
The success of statistical arbitrage relies on continuous monitoring and adaptation. Traders need to stay updated with market conditions, adjust their strategies as correlations or patterns evolve, and incorporate new data into their models.
Tools for Cryptocurrency Arbitrage
To compete effectively in this fast-paced field, traders leverage a variety of specialized tools to source real-time pricing data, locate discrepancies, and execute simultaneous cross-exchange orders at blistering speeds.
Price Tracking APIs
Nearly all major exchanges expose public APIs for devs to build apps fetching granular market stats programmatically. This feeds trading algorithms.
Arbitrage Screening Bots
Custom trading robots constantly scan price quotes, identify potential arbitrage pairs based on preset thresholds, then auto-trade any anomalies found.
Distributed Exchange Interfaces
Startups like 0x, and DDEX are creating standardized protocols to easily move assets between different chains and platforms for consolidated arbitrage potentials.
Multi-Exchange Portfolios
Advance trading platforms like 3Commas allow creating multi-exchange order configurations to capitalize as single algorithmic workflows.
Challenges and Risks in Cryptocurrency Arbitrage
While cryptocurrency arbitrage presents lucrative opportunities, it is essential for traders to be aware of the challenges and risks involved. Below are the key challenges and risks associated with cryptocurrency arbitrage.
Market Volatility
Cryptocurrency markets are notorious for their high volatility. Prices can experience rapid and significant fluctuations within short periods. This volatility poses a challenge for arbitrage traders as price disparities observed at one moment may disappear or worsen before trades can be executed. The volatile nature of cryptocurrency markets requires traders to act swiftly and efficiently to capitalize on arbitrage opportunities.
Liquidity Constraints
Liquidity disparities across exchanges can pose challenges to cryptocurrency arbitrage. Some exchanges may have low trading volumes or limited liquidity for certain cryptocurrencies, making it difficult to execute trades quickly and at desired prices. Arbitrageurs may encounter slippage, where the execution price differs from the expected price due to insufficient liquidity. Liquidity constraints can impact the profitability and feasibility of arbitrage strategies.
Exchange Limitations and Delays
Cryptocurrency exchanges differ in their operational efficiency, trading features, and support. Some exchanges may have limitations on deposits, withdrawals, or trading volumes, which can impede the smooth execution of arbitrage trades. Delays in deposit or withdrawal processing times can affect the speed and profitability of arbitrage strategies. Technical issues or system outages on exchanges can also disrupt trading activities and hinder arbitrage opportunities.
Counterparty and Security Risks
Engaging with multiple exchanges and counterparties in cryptocurrency arbitrage introduces counterparty and security risks. Traders need to carefully evaluate the reputation and security measures of the exchanges they trade on. Counterparty risks include the potential for exchange hacks, scams, or insolvencies, which can lead to loss of funds. Implementing security measures such as two-factor authentication and storing funds in secure wallets can help mitigate these risks.
Regulatory and Compliance Factors
Cryptocurrency regulations vary across jurisdictions, and compliance requirements can impact arbitrage strategies. Traders need to understand and adhere to the legal and regulatory frameworks of the countries they operate in. Compliance with anti-money laundering (AML) and know-your-customer (KYC) regulations may introduce additional steps and delays in the trading process, affecting the speed and efficiency of arbitrage trades.
Technological Risks
Cryptocurrency arbitrage relies heavily on technology, including trading platforms, order execution mechanisms, and data feeds. Technological risks such as system failures, connectivity issues, or data inaccuracies can disrupt trading activities and lead to losses. Traders should ensure they have access to reliable and robust trading infrastructure to mitigate technological risks.
Financial Risks
Arbitrage involves a certain level of financial risk. Prices may not always revert to their expected values, and traders may incur losses if price disparities persist or worsen. Also, fluctuations in cryptocurrency prices can impact the profitability of arbitrage strategies. Traders should carefully manage their capital allocation, implement risk management techniques, and assess the potential risks versus rewards of each arbitrage opportunity.
Regulatory Changes and Market Sentiment
Cryptocurrency markets are influenced by regulatory changes, market sentiment, and news events. Shifts in regulations or negative news can lead to sudden price movements and volatility, affecting the profitability of arbitrage trades. Arbitrageurs need to stay updated with market trends, news developments, and regulatory changes to assess the potential impact on their arbitrage strategies.
8 Best Practices for Cryptocurrency Arbitrage
Outlined below are some best practices that can help traders maximize their chances of success and minimize potential.
1. Thorough Research and Analysis
Before engaging in cryptocurrency arbitrage, thorough research and analysis are essential. Traders should study the market dynamics, historical price data, and trends of the cryptocurrencies they plan to trade. They should also research the exchanges they will be using, including their reputation, security measures, trading volumes, liquidity, and fees. By gathering comprehensive information, traders can make informed decisions and identify the most promising arbitrage opportunities.
2. Start with Established Exchanges
When starting out in cryptocurrency arbitrage, it is advisable to begin with established and reputable exchanges. These exchanges have a track record of reliability, security, and liquidity. By trading on reputable exchanges, traders can reduce the risk of encountering issues such as hacks, scams, or liquidity constraints. As traders gain experience and confidence, they can explore opportunities on other exchanges.
3 Risk Management
Implementing effective risk management strategies is crucial in cryptocurrency arbitrage. Traders should set clear risk tolerance levels and adhere to them. This includes determining the maximum amount of capital to allocate to each trade and setting stop loss orders to limit potential losses. Diversifying investments across multiple cryptocurrencies and exchanges can also help mitigate risks. By managing risks effectively, traders can protect their capital and minimize the impact of adverse market movements.
4. Real-Time Monitoring
Cryptocurrency markets can change rapidly, so real-time monitoring is vital for successful arbitrage. Traders should use reliable tools, platforms, or software that provide real-time data on cryptocurrency prices, trading volumes, and order books across multiple exchanges. By staying updated with market conditions, traders can identify arbitrage opportunities as they arise and execute trades promptly.
5. Efficient Execution
Efficient execution is critical in cryptocurrency arbitrage. Traders should ensure they have accounts and funds readily available on the exchanges they plan to trade on. This includes considering deposit and withdrawal times, as delays can affect the speed and profitability of arbitrage trades. Additionally, using trading bots or automation tools can help execute trades swiftly and accurately, especially when dealing with multiple exchanges simultaneously.
6. Compliance and Regulatory Considerations
Cryptocurrency regulations vary across jurisdictions, and traders should be aware of the legal and compliance requirements in the countries they operate in. Compliance with AML and KYC regulations may be necessary when trading on regulated exchanges. Traders should ensure they understand and adhere to the applicable regulations to avoid legal issues or disruptions to their trading activities.
7. Continuous Learning and Adaptation
Cryptocurrency markets are dynamic and constantly evolving. Traders should maintain a mindset of continuous learning and adaptation. They should stay informed about market trends, news, technological advancements, and regulatory developments. Additionally, analyzing past trades, reviewing strategies, and learning from both successes and failures can help traders refine their approach and improve their future performance.
8. Keep Records and Track Performance
Keeping detailed records and tracking performance is essential in cryptocurrency arbitrage. Traders should maintain a record of all trades, including entry and exit points, transaction details, and outcomes. This information can provide valuable insights for evaluating the effectiveness of strategies, identifying areas for improvement, and assessing overall performance.
Final Thoughts
In closing, cryptocurrency arbitrage leverages transient pricing anomalies across fragmented global markets to produce non-directional profits. While technically simple, its consistent execution demands state-of-the-art tools integrating real-time data feeds with automatic trading logic.
Accessible even for part-time traders, arbitrage cultivates analytical problem-solving abilities applicable far beyond a single strategy. With diligent learning, practice managing risk, and patience to develop specialized techniques, its methodical income style appeals to traders of all experience levels.
As digital currencies continue proliferating worldwide, so too will emerging arbitrage windows—benefiting optimally prepared participants for years to come.